循环流程图怎么画?流程图的三种循环画法分享

2023-07-05 18:06:57 标签: 流程图  
  我们知道流程图是一种可用于梳理事件具体流程和算法流程的图示。其中事件流程即用图示呈现事件的顺序与走向信息,绘制起来往往得心应手;而用流程图表示算法时不少小伙伴会为呈现循环结构而犯难,那么循环流程图怎么画呢?下面迅哥分享三种循环流程图的画法,教大家绘制算法流程图。

一、三种循环结构

  我们知道程序编写常见的循环结构有三种,即for循环、while循环和do while循环结构。

1、for循环

  执行步骤:
  (1)首先将循环控制变量初始化;
  (2)接着对循环进行判断,若判断为真则进入到循环结构;若判断为假则退出循环;
  (3)执行循环结构内容,并进入到循环结构变量,
  (4)继续进入到循环结构。

for循环流程图

2、while循环

  执行步骤:
  (1)首先将循环控制变量初始化;
  (2)接着对循环进行判断,若判断为真则执行循环结构;若判断为假不执行循环结构;
  (3)执行循环结构内容,并继续进入到循环结构。
  (4)继续进入到循环结构。

while循环流程图

3、do while循环

  (1)首先将循环控制变量初始化;
  (2)接着执行循环结构内容;
  (3)对循环内容进行判断,若判断为真则执行循环结构;若判断为假则退出循环;

do while循环

二、呈现循环结构

  简单梳理好for、while和do while三种循环结构的特点后,就可以试着将循环结构呈现至流程图中。
  当然了,细心的小伙伴会发现,这三种循环结构与“流程图规范”所讲流程图三种基本结构的循环结构大同小异。

流程图结构

  对于循环结构的绘制一般只需通过常用的起止框、判断框和处理框三种符号即可完成。因此使用鼠标将所需的图形符号添加至画布区域,并根据算法进行梳理并连接即可。至于其它步骤与“流程图怎么画”所述的绘制方法大同小异。
  注:算法流程图所涉及的符号还有很多,如输出输入框、文件框、数据库等。

循环流程图

三、循环流程图模板

  为方便小伙伴们制图,迅捷画图的模板库还预置有诸多实际的算法流程图模板,可从中选择合适的模板进行套用,方便快速制图,以及学习梳理方法。

流程图模板库

1、最小公倍数算法流程图


最小公倍数算法流程图

2、遗传算法流程图


遗传算法流程图

3、Switch语句流程图


Switch语句流程图

  以上就是循环流程图的画法了,小伙伴们可以尝试着绘制一个循环流程图,以便更好地理解循环结构,并在实践中应用循环结构解决问题。
x
迅捷思维导图APP
多端互通可离线使用 一键导出专业脑图
免费下载APP